在当今数字化与区块链深度融合的时代,NFT 视频平台与视频直播 APP 搭建成为热门领域,定制开发成品视频 APP 源码需求也日益增长。那么,在技术开发过程中,究竟会遇到哪些棘手问题,又该如何解决呢? 以某 NFT 视频平台开发项目为例,该项目旨在为用户提供独特的 NFT 视频展示与交易体验。在技术选型上,后端采用 ...
在当今数字化与区块链深度融合的时代,NFT 视频平台与视频直播 APP 搭建成为热门领域,定制开发成品视频 APP 源码需求也日益增长。那么,在技术开发过程中,究竟会遇到哪些棘手问题,又该如何解决呢?
定制开发、NFT视频平台、视频直播APP搭建、成品视频APP源码、技术开发、开发" style="max-width: 100%; height: auto; border-radius: 8px; box-shadow: 0 2px 8px rgba(0,0,0,0.1);" />
以某 NFT 视频平台开发项目为例,该项目旨在为用户提供独特的 NFT 视频展示与交易体验。在技术选型上,后端采用 Go 语言结合 Gin 框架,其高性能与高并发处理能力,能有效应对大量用户同时访问。数据库选用 MongoDB,灵活的文档结构适合存储复杂的 NFT 元数据。前端则运用 React 框架,构建响应式界面,提升用户体验。
与常见的视频直播 APP 搭建相比,NFT 视频平台在技术实现上有显著差异。视频直播 APP 更注重实时流媒体传输,常采用 RTMP、HLS 等协议,通过 FFmpeg 进行视频编码与推流。例如,使用 Node.js 结合 Socket.IO 实现实时互动功能,确保主播与观众的低延迟通信。而 NFT 视频平台,除视频播放外,核心在于 NFT 的铸造、交易与版权管理。这需要集成区块链技术,如以太坊,利用智能合约确保 NFT 的唯一性与所有权转移的安全性。在代码实现上,通过 Web3.js 或 Ethers.js 与区块链交互,编写智能合约代码,定义 NFT 的属性与交易规则。
在开发过程中,也面临诸多挑战。如 NFT 视频的版权保护,需采用数字水印技术与区块链相结合,防止视频被盗用。同时,平台的性能优化至关重要,对于大量视频数据的存储与检索,可采用分布式存储系统,如 Ceph,提高数据读写效率。
综合来看,若想开发此类平台,对于有独特功能需求、追求个性化用户体验的项目,定制开发是首选,尽管成本较高,但能精准满足业务需求。若项目对时间与成本较为敏感,且功能需求常规,成品视频 APP 源码经二次开发也是可行方案,但需注意源码的质量与兼容性。
总之,无论是定制开发还是基于成品源码二次开发,明确技术选型、深入理解业务需求、解决关键技术难题,都是打造成功 NFT 视频平台或视频直播 APP 的关键。只有这样,才能在激烈的市场竞争中脱颖而出,为用户提供优质的产品与服务。